What is it like to work at Synovus?

Synovus is a community-focused bank that prioritizes a culture of teamwork, integrity, and customer service, fostering a collaborative and supportive work environment.

The company's team structure is organized around a regional model, with employees working closely with colleagues in their local markets to deliver personalized banking solutions to customers. Synovus' mission is to make its communities a better place to live, work, and thrive, which is reflected in its community development initiatives and volunteer programs.

Working at Synovus may appeal to candidates who value community involvement, are passionate about delivering exceptional customer service, and are looking for a stable and secure career in the financial industry.

Job description

Job Summary
Serves as the front-line point of contact for retail branch customers executing activities required to meet sales and service needs of customers and branch goals and objectives. Operates as a multi-functional team member with the ability to process transactions, provide optimum service, and consult in an advisory role to maximize the sales potential of every interaction. Processes transactions accurately and efficiently while simultaneously introducing products, services and digital options that meet customer needs and encourages customers to expand their relationship with Synovus. Identifies customer needs as well as cross-selling and up-selling opportunities. Expands and retains customer relationships and contributes to the financial growth of the branch. Serves as the first line of defense in preventing fraud and mitigating risk. Demonstrates passion for delighting customers by living the Customer Covenant every day. On average, spends approximately 60% of time performing Teller functions and 40% of time performing Relationship Banker functions.

Minimum Education:
  • High school diploma or equivalent

Minimum experience:
  • 1+ years of experience in the banking industry including cash handling, sales and customer service;
    OR
    6 months successful sales experience where defined goals and accountabilities were routinely met.
    May consider relevant college-related programs in lieu of some, not all job experience.

Certifications or Licenses:
  • This position requires successful registration and issuance of a unique identification number from the Nationwide Mortgage Licensing System (NMLS) in compliance with the Secure and Fair Enforcement for Mortgage Licensing Act of 2008 (SAFE ACT). Registration must be accomplished within an established timeframe after initial employment and includes a nationwide finger print check.
